Writing this one after using it for a few weeks...

Where do I start? With all the people around me starting to crave pancakes for some unknown reason? Maybe the hummingbirds not leaving for the winter and instead following me around the yard? I don't know honestly, all I can say is it is soooooooooooo good. The aroma smells like home cooked breakfast, minus the bacon. Imagine a warm kitchen on a cold winters day and you wake up to the smell of food in the kitchen, waffles, pancakes, butter, syrup, love. If you can imagine that, you have the smell of this as you vape it and we have not even gotten to the taste yet.

The taste is, well, complex to say the least. Yes it is sweet, but not in an overpowering way. During the draw you get a sweet taste, honeysuckle, light but still sweet. Once you go for your inhale after drawing it into your mouth, it is more of a light maple syrup feeling. I would swear on the exhale you get a little butter along with the heavier maple taste. Again nothing overpowering, but you know for a fact you are vaping something meant to have a sweetness to it. You will not be able to keep from licking your lips ever few exhales.

I like it better fresh, when it's fresh--and I like it better steeped after it's steeped. Though I think the fresh thing is more the novelty of it since I generally get 60ml at a time and so unsteeped BB is relatively rare here.

If you have the atty/carto for it, you may want to try it once a day. The taste changes every day, at least for most people, and experiencing the journey to finished flavour can be fascinating. At least once, anyway ;)

I have been dripping it and have two tanks of various size sitting and steeping on their own. I am going to have to get a nice big bottle of it and let it steep for a few months. Mine is much darker than the new bottle as well.

I generally get about 60ml a month, and it always surprises me how much lighter the new bottle is than the "current stock."

Lately I've been getting about 30ml a month of the BRM and it doesn't darken up nearly as much in that time frame. The flavour doesn't seem to change as much, either...

Peach is one of the more common flavours people taste when it's fresh off the line. Mango is second, I think. To me it's mainly just "unidentifiably fruity," but that goes away compleatly. For me. Some people say it just subsides to a very faint undertone.

I think I just cannot replicate a flavour. Butterfly Bait is based on a suggestion of mine (from the very first contest Mom and Pop held here on ECF) and it seems to taste different to everyone. Calipitter Chow is my recipe, developed tested and finalized before I even sent a sample to Mom and Pop to see what they thought of it, and it definitely tastes different to everyone. Luckily most people seem to like them, but it makes it really hard to answer the question "what does it taste like?" :laugh:

No, I didn't write that. Someone may have, but Butterfly Bait seems to finish within seven days to my taste buds. I think Calipitter Chow may be a bit more variable, but I know the hot bath method decreases the steep time on it to about 24 hours--but I've never tried that it Butterfly Bait. Totally different components, so the "power steep" method may or may not work with BB...


EDIT: I believe a couple of the tobacco aficionados may have stated that the Haze or Praze takes 30 days to fully mature, but I don't do tobacco flavours so I'm not 100% sure about that...
